Description Ten Ounce Silver Koala coins are manufactured by the Perth Mint of Australia. The first Koala was minted in 2007. The Koala has an annually changing design on the reverse and a portrait of Her Late Majesty Queen Elizabeth II on the obverse. The Koala is one of the most popular animals from Australia and recognised for its bear-like appearance and grey fur. The Perth Mint also makes other popular coins from Australia such as the Kangaroo and the Kookaburra. These coins contain ten troy ounces of silver and have a purity of 99.9%.
